La Breve y Maravillosa Vida de Oscar Wao (The Brief Wondrous Life of Oscar Wao) is an adaptation based on Junot Diaz’s novel of the same name. The title character is a self-described nerd from New Jersey who studies at Rutgers and dreams of becoming the Dominican J.R.R. Tolkien, all while trying to escape the shadow of his Dominican mother. Standing in the way of his hopes is fuku, the curse that has haunted the Wao family across generations and the ocean between their ancestral Santo Domingo home and current home in the US.
